Q: Is 1,675,010 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 1,675,010 is a composite number.

Why is 1,675,010 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 1,675,010 can be evenly divided by 1 2 5 10 17 34 59 85 118 167 170 295 334 590 835 1,003 1,670 2,006 2,839 5,015 5,678 9,853 10,030 14,195 19,706 28,390 49,265 98,530 167,501 335,002 837,505 and 1,675,010, with no remainder.

Since 1,675,010 cannot be divided by just 1 and 1,675,010, it is a composite number.
